Debates and Drawing!
Year 5 have been working hard again this week and taken on some new challenges! They continued to help out in the farm, until the animals left for their new winter homes. We look forward to welcoming them back in the spring!
During IPC, the students planned, rehearsed and argued their points of view surrounding a topical news issue - a debate about whether children should be encouraged to take part in e-sports. Both sides argued their points clearly and concisely, however most students felt that it would be best to take part in e-sports when they were older! A very mature approach!
In Maths, the students have been learning how to translate shapes on 1, 2 and 4 quadrant coordinate grids! They have shown resilience when extra concentration and brain power were needed to comprehend the trickier aspects of this topic. Well done!
